Is there anything worse than your AC dying in the middle of a July heatwave? You are sweating, stressed, and staring at a $1,200 repair quote. Now you face the ultimate homeowner dilemma: do you patch the dying machine or invest in a new one? Before you write that check, you need to see the math behind the numbers AC repair vs replace.
This is the simplest litmus test. The Rule: If the cost of the repair is 50% or more of the cost of a brand-new system, do not repair it. Replace it immediately.
The Logic: You wouldn't pay $10,000 to fix the engine of a car worth $15,000. The same applies here. A repair which is expensive indicates catastrophic failure.
The Exception: If your system is less than 5 years old and under warranty, the parts should be free. You are only paying for labor. In this case, always repair.
This formula is more nuanced because it accounts for the age of your unit. The Formula: Multiply the Age of the Unit (in Years) by the Estimated Repair Cost.
The Verdict:
If the total is less than $5,000, repair it.
If the total is more than $5,000, replace it.
Let’s run a real-world scenario: You have a 12-year-old AC unit that needs a $600 fan motor repair.
Math: 12 (Years) x $600 (Cost) = $7,200.
Result: Replace. Why? The average life of an AC unit is around 15 years. Because at 12 years old, your system is statistically at the end of its life. Spending $600 now is likely just the first of many payments.
Scenario B: You have a 6-year-old unit that needs a $600 repair.
Math: 6 (Years) x $600 (Cost) = $3,600.
Result: Repair. This unit has plenty of life left.
In 2026, there is a "deal" factor that usually tips the scale toward replacement: Government Incentives. Under the Inflation Reduction Act, homeowners are eligible for massive tax credits for installing high-efficiency heat pumps and AC units.
The Deal: You can claim 30% of the project cost (up to $2,000 per year) as a federal tax credit.
The Math: If a new system costs $8,000, the government essentially gives you a $2,000 coupon come tax season.
Suddenly, the "net cost" of that new system is $6,000.
If you were facing a $2,500 repair on an old machine, the gap between "patching the old" and "buying the new" shrinks dramatically.
Warning: Check the SEER2 rating. To qualify, the new unit must meet specific high-efficiency standards (usually 16 SEER2 or higher).
If your system was built before 2010, it likely uses R-22 (Freon). This refrigerant is banned in the US.
The Reality: You can still find R-22, but it costs liquid gold, often $150 to $300 per pound. If your system has a leak and needs 6 pounds of refrigerant, the refill alone could cost $1,000.
The Verdict: Never repair a leaking R-22 system. It is a money pit. Modern systems use R-410A (Puron) or the newer R-454B, which are cheaper and better for the planet.
